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Cleaver
What are the primary responsibilities of a Cleaver?
The primary responsibilities of a Cleaver include preparing meat for sale by cutting, trimming, and boning. They must also maintain a clean and safe work environment, and adhere to all food safety regulations.
What are the key skills required to be a successful Cleaver?
Successful Cleavers typically have strong knife skills, as well as a good understanding of meat cuts and primal cuts. They must also be able to work quickly and efficiently in a fast-paced environment, and be able to maintain a clean and safe work area.
What are the career prospects for Cleavers?
Cleavers with experience and additional training may be able to advance to supervisory or management positions within the meat processing industry. Some Cleavers may also choose to start their own businesses.
What is the average salary for a Cleaver?
The average salary for a Cleaver in the United States is around $35,000 per year. However, salaries can vary depending on experience, location, and employer.
What are the working conditions like for Cleavers?
Cleavers typically work in cold, wet, and slippery environments. They may also have to work long hours, including weekends and holidays. However, many Cleavers find the work to be rewarding and enjoy the satisfaction of working with their hands.
What is the job outlook for Cleavers?
The job outlook for Cleavers is expected to be good over the next few years. The increasing demand for meat products is expected to lead to increased demand for Cleavers.
What are the educational requirements for Cleavers?
Most Cleavers have a high school diploma or equivalent. However, some employers may prefer candidates with a college degree in a related field, such as animal science or food science.
What are the certification requirements for Cleavers?
Cleavers are not required to have any specific certifications. However, some employers may prefer candidates who have completed a food safety training program or who have experience working in a meat processing plant.
